COMMISSIONERS CERTIFICATE. To His Excellency KINSLEY S. BINGHAM, Governor of the State of Michigan: We, the Commissioners appointed pursuant to an Act entitled "An Act to Collect, Compile and Reprint the Laws of this State," approved February 2, 1857, do hereby Certify, that we have examined the Laws collected and arranged, by THOMAS M. COOLEY, Esquire, the person appointed by the Legislature to perform that service, and have found the Laws so collected and arranged, to be a correct Compilation of all General Laws in force. HOVEY K. CLARKE, ALBERT M. BAKER. of premises by plaintiffs in ejectment, 1239. of children under six years age, ABATEMENT, 1508. of suits in chancery, provisions concerning, 1016 to PLEAS IN by joint drawers of bill or note, 1149. to be verified by affidavit or other evidence, 1057, to indictment, to be verified, 1586. by death, marriage, etc., 1156. when death of sole plaintiff or defendant not to abate death of one of sole plaintiffs or defendants not to proceedings in partition not abated by death, 1158. 1159. of actions in ejectment, not to abate by death, etc., 1235. misnaming of corporation to be pleaded in, 1291. of suits by and against public officers or bodies, 1309.
